NPI #
509 Elm St
Garberville, CA, 95542-3204
Ambulatory Health Care Facilities
Clinic/Center
Multi-Specialty
261QM1300X
101 West Coast Road
Redway, CA, 95560
101 West Coast Rd
Redway, CA, 95560-0769